KMSAuto Lite is a compact, portable tool created to activate Microsoft products without requiring an official retail license key. The "Portable" designation means the software does not require a standard installation process; it can run directly from a USB flash drive or a local folder.

The most severe risk stemming from KMSAuto Lite involves malware exposure. Because it is an unofficial tool distributed across third-party websites, peer-to-peer networks, and unverified forums, malicious actors frequently bundle the activator with dangerous payloads. Users downloading the utility risk infecting their systems with: Ransomware that locks local files.

Small businesses and educational institutions can leverage official Microsoft volume licensing programs, which offer legal KMS or MAK (Multiple Activation Key) configurations tailored to tight budgets.

Legitimate KMS activations are temporary and expire after 180 days. Client machines must periodically reconnect to the local network server to renew their activation status automatically. The KMSAuto Lite Emulation Method
